How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Outer Southeast Fort Worth?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Outer Southeast Fort Worth Studio Apartments | $1,186 | $700 | $2,150 |
Outer Southeast Fort Worth 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,443 | $675 | $5,402 |
Outer Southeast Fort Worth 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,868 | $750 | $10,000+ |
Outer Southeast Fort Worth 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,342 | $799 | $10,000+ |
Outer Southeast Fort Worth 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,543 | $614 | $8,870 |
